Handheld massagers utilize percussive therapy, a technique that dates back to the early 1900s and gained popularity in the 1970s thanks to athletes like Jack Nicklaus promoting its benefits. Percussion devices work by producing vibrations that penetrate deep into muscle fibers, enhancing flexibility and range of motion. These vibrations mimic the effects of a high-quality massage, which professionals have long used to improve muscle elasticity and flexibility.

In practical terms, the device acts like your personal masseuse, but one that is available all the time, at home, without the $100 hourly fee. I usually take 10 to 15 minutes after a workout—or even after a long day at my desk—to focus on areas like my hamstrings, quads, and calves. The specifications of most handheld massagers allow for adjustable speeds. I absolutely love using a device with a range between 1500 to 3200 percussions per minute, so I can control the intensity to suit my needs.

One of the remarkable features of these massagers is their ability to break down adhesions and trigger points. Picture this: you’ve just completed a 5-mile run and your calves are tight and painful. A handheld massager directs force and pressure precisely into these areas, effectively kneading out knots and releasing built-up tension.
